diff --git a/OCH/mogo-och-bus/src/main/java/com/mogo/och/bus/fragment/BaseOchBusTabFragment.java b/OCH/mogo-och-bus/src/main/java/com/mogo/och/bus/fragment/BaseOchBusTabFragment.java index d225ad6729..1ff52a0d9c 100644 --- a/OCH/mogo-och-bus/src/main/java/com/mogo/och/bus/fragment/BaseOchBusTabFragment.java +++ b/OCH/mogo-och-bus/src/main/java/com/mogo/och/bus/fragment/BaseOchBusTabFragment.java @@ -200,16 +200,13 @@ public abstract class BaseOchBusTabFragment { - CallerHmiManager.INSTANCE.showBadCaseEntrance(mBadcaseBtn); - }); CallerHmiManager.INSTANCE.registerBadCaseCallback( () -> { // onShow() - mBadcaseBtn.setVisibility(View.VISIBLE); + CallerHmiManager.INSTANCE.showBadCaseEntrance(mBadcaseBtn); return null; }, () -> { // onHide() - mBadcaseBtn.setVisibility(View.GONE); return null; }); } diff --git a/OCH/mogo-och-taxi/src/main/java/com/mogo/och/taxi/ui/BaseOchTaxiTabFragment.java b/OCH/mogo-och-taxi/src/main/java/com/mogo/och/taxi/ui/BaseOchTaxiTabFragment.java index 368ee2c879..76097c420e 100644 --- a/OCH/mogo-och-taxi/src/main/java/com/mogo/och/taxi/ui/BaseOchTaxiTabFragment.java +++ b/OCH/mogo-och-taxi/src/main/java/com/mogo/och/taxi/ui/BaseOchTaxiTabFragment.java @@ -133,16 +133,13 @@ public abstract class BaseOchTaxiTabFragment { - CallerHmiManager.INSTANCE.showBadCaseEntrance(mBadcaseBtn); - }); CallerHmiManager.INSTANCE.registerBadCaseCallback( () -> { // onShow() - mBadcaseBtn.setVisibility(View.VISIBLE); + CallerHmiManager.INSTANCE.showBadCaseEntrance(mBadcaseBtn); return null; }, () -> { // onHide() - mBadcaseBtn.setVisibility(View.GONE); return null; }); panelView = LayoutInflater.from(getContext()).inflate(getStationPanelViewId(), flStationPanelContainer);